UK Construction Blacklisting Scandal – It’s a Disgrace!
According to reports in today’s construction media Contractors involved in the construction blacklisting scandal have settled claims with another 180 workers.
Campaigners claimed the latest payouts totaled “in the region of £15-20 million plus legal costs” and come ahead of the full blacklist trial set to start at the High Court on May 9 and scheduled to run until July 31.
Eight contractors – Balfour Beatty, Carillion, Costain, Kier, Laing O’Rourke, Sir Robert McAlpine, Skanska UK and Vinci PLC – have set up The Construction Workers Compensation Scheme to try and settle with victims out of court.
A spokeswoman for the Contractors confirmed that 180 new settlements had been reached, and the Blacklist Support Group said there are currently 154 live claims remaining plus 82 recently issued new claims.
